  4. Puckpilot is 100% correct with his advice. With proper technique, you can totally set aside stick measurements. Yes, a different length or lie might help... but even then, you still want to learn and use proper techniques. Im 5’8” barefoot. The average uncut stick is usually ridiculously long for me. Earlier on, I used that length... but I had to be even more focused on technique, otherwise pucks would be sliding right under my blade and I’d be whiffing on shots... etc. I immediately jumped to your conclusion and lowered my lie. Yes, it made things a little easier... but I was still required to maintain control over a stick that was way too long. Finally, I went back to a 5.5/6 lie and cut the stick. This brought the blade to a better position, as well as improved my ability to handle the stick. The bottom line is that technique always comes first. But after that, you need to find the best balance of length and lie for your body/stance/preferences. You’re tall, but mentioned that your proportions are off (short legs/knuckle dragger arms). Try cutting a stick to a length where the blade lays on the ice evenly, and see what you think. It will also help with the hand positioning you are looking for. If you later realize that you did prefer the old length... THEN look into a lower lie.
